/**
* @public
*
* Helper for writing compiler transforms that apply "map" and/or "filter"-style
* operations to compiler contexts. The `visitor` argument accepts a map of IR
* kinds to user-defined functions that can map nodes of that kind to new values
* (of the same kind).
*
* If a visitor function is defined for a kind, the visitor function is
* responsible for traversing its children (by calling `this.traverse(node)`)
* and returning either the input (to indicate no changes), a new node (to
* indicate changes), or null/undefined (to indicate the removal of that node
* from the output).
*
* If a visitor function is *not* defined for a kind, a default traversal is
* used to evaluate its children.
*
* The `stateInitializer` argument accepts an optional function to construct the
* state for each document (fragment or root) in the context. Any documents for
* which the initializer returns null/undefined is deleted from the context
* without being traversed.
*
* Example: Alias all scalar fields with the reverse of their name:
*
* ```
* transform(context, {
* ScalarField: visitScalarField,
* });
*
* function visitScalarField(field: ScalarField, state: State): ?ScalarField {
* // Traverse child nodes - for a scalar field these are the arguments &
* // directives.
* const nextField = this.traverse(field, state);
* // Return a new node with a different alias.
* return {
* ...nextField,
* alias: nextField.name.split('').reverse().join(''),
* };
* }
* ```
*/
function transform(context, visitor, stateInitializer) {
var transformer = new Transformer(context, visitor);
return context.withMutations(function (ctx) {
var nextContext = ctx;
eachWithCombinedError(context.documents(), function (prevNode) {
var nextNode;
if (stateInitializer === undefined) {
nextNode = transformer.visit(prevNode, undefined);
} else {
var _state = stateInitializer(prevNode);
if (_state != null) {
nextNode = transformer.visit(prevNode, _state);
}
}
if (!nextNode) {
nextContext = nextContext.remove(prevNode.name);
} else if (nextNode !== prevNode) {
nextContext = nextContext.replace(nextNode);
}
});
return nextContext;
});
}
/**
* @internal
*/
var Transformer = /*#__PURE__*/ (function () {
function Transformer(context, visitor) {
this._context = context;
this._states = [];
this._visitor = visitor;
}
/**
* @public
*
* Returns the original compiler context that is being transformed. This can
* be used to look up fragments by name, for example.
*/
var _proto = Transformer.prototype;
_proto.getContext = function getContext() {
return this._context;
};
/**
* @public
*
* Transforms the node, calling a user-defined visitor function if defined for
* the node's kind. Uses the given state for this portion of the traversal.
*
* Note: This differs from `traverse` in that it calls a visitor function for
* the node itself.
*/
_proto.visit = function visit(node, state) {
this._states.push(state);
var nextNode = this._visit(node);
this._states.pop();
return nextNode;
};
/**
* @public
*
* Transforms the children of the given node, skipping the user-defined
* visitor function for the node itself. Uses the given state for this portion
* of the traversal.
*
* Note: This differs from `visit` in that it does not call a visitor function
* for the node itself.
*/
_proto.traverse = function traverse(node, state) {
this._states.push(state);
var nextNode = this._traverse(node);
this._states.pop();
return nextNode;
};
_proto._visit = function _visit(node) {
var nodeVisitor = this._visitor[node.kind];
if (nodeVisitor) {
// If a handler for the kind is defined, it is responsible for calling
// `traverse` to transform children as necessary.
var _state2 = this._getState();
var nextNode = nodeVisitor.call(this, node, _state2);
return nextNode;
} // Otherwise traverse is called automatically.
return this._traverse(node);
};
